Titanium: lattice energies

titanium symbol icon

All values of lattice energies are quoted in kJ mol-1.

Fluorides

  • TiF2:
    thermochemical cycle: (no value) kJ mol-1
    calculated: 2724 kJ mol-1
  • TiF3:
    thermochemical cycle: (no value) kJ mol-1
    calculated: 5644 kJ mol-1
  • TiF4:
    thermochemical cycle: 9908 kJ mol-1
    calculated: 10012 kJ mol-1

Chlorides

  • TiCl2:
    thermochemical cycle: 2501 kJ mol-1
    calculated: 2431 kJ mol-1
  • TiCl3:
    thermochemical cycle: 5134 kJ mol-1
    calculated: 5134 kJ mol-1
  • TiCl4:
    thermochemical cycle: (no value) kJ mol-1
    calculated: 9431 kJ mol-1

Bromides

  • TiBr2:
    thermochemical cycle: 2419 kJ mol-1
    calculated: 2360 kJ mol-1
  • TiBr3:
    thermochemical cycle: 5007 kJ mol-1
    calculated: 5012 kJ mol-1
  • TiBr4:
    thermochemical cycle: 9039 kJ mol-1
    calculated: 9288 kJ mol-1

Iodides

  • TiI2:
    thermochemical cycle: 2329 kJ mol-1
    calculated: 2259 kJ mol-1
  • TiI3:
    thermochemical cycle: (no value) kJ mol-1
    calculated: 4845 kJ mol-1
  • TiI4:
    thermochemical cycle: 8893 kJ mol-1
    calculated: 9108 kJ mol-1

Hydrides

  • TiH:
    thermochemical cycle: 1407 kJ mol-1
    calculated: 996 kJ mol-1
  • TiH2:
    thermochemical cycle: (no value) kJ mol-1
    calculated: 2866 kJ mol-1
  • TiH3:
    thermochemical cycle: 2845 kJ mol-1
    calculated: (no value) kJ mol-1

Oxides

  • TiO:
    thermochemical cycle: 3811 kJ mol-1
    calculated: 3832 kJ mol-1
  • Ti2O3:
    thermochemical cycle: 14149 kJ mol-1
    calculated: 14702 kJ mol-1
  • TiO2:
    thermochemical cycle: (no value) kJ mol-1
    calculated: 12150 kJ mol-1

References

  1. H.D.B. Jenkins - personal communication. I am grateful to Dr Don Jenkins (University of Warwick, UK) who provided the lattice energy data, which are adapted from his contribution contained within reference 2.
  2. H.D.B. Jenkins in CRC Handbook of Chemistry and Physics 1999-2000 : A Ready-Reference Book of Chemical and Physical Data (CRC Handbook of Chemistry and Physics, D.R. Lide, (ed.), CRC Press, Boca Raton, Florida, USA, 79th edition, 1998.
